比特币交易运作原理:从输入到确认的完整指南

·

比特币作为去中心化数字资产的代表,其交易机制是区块链技术的核心应用之一。本文将深入解析比特币交易的全流程,包括密钥机制、交易特性、验证过程及常见问题,帮助读者全面理解这一革命性支付系统的运作方式。

比特币交易的基本原理

比特币交易本质上是价值在两个钱包地址间的转移记录,这些记录通过区块链网络公开存储并验证。每一笔交易都需由发送方使用私钥进行数字签名,以证明对资金的所有权。

UTXO模型:交易的核心框架

比特币采用“未花费交易输出”(UTXO)模型来管理交易完整性:

  1. 交易输入与输出:每个交易消耗一个或多个现有UTXO,并生成新的UTXO作为接收方的资金和找零
  2. 实际案例:假设Alice持有1 BTC和3 BTC两个UTXO,她需要向Bob转账2 BTC。她将消耗两个现有UTXO,创建两个新UTXO:2 BTC发送至Bob的地址,2 BTC作为找零返回自身钱包(此处案例中找零计算有误,实际应返回2 BTC找零,但原文表述为4 BTC,保留原文数据但注明问题)
  3. 交易验证:交易经签名后广播至网络,矿工验证其有效性后打包至新区块
  4. 链上确认:新区块被加入区块链后,交易获得首次确认,随后区块的连续追加提供额外确认

👉 实时查看区块链交易状态

公钥与私钥:安全交易的基石

密钥对的作用机制

邮箱类比理解

将比特币系统比作邮箱系统:

比特币交易的四大特征

1. 不可逆性

交易一经区块链确认即无法撤销。这种特性在防止欺诈的同时也要求用户转账时务必确认接收地址准确无误。

2. 伪匿名性

交易记录公开可查,但地址不与现实世界身份直接关联。尽管通过链分析可能追踪资金流向,但直接对应真人身份仍具挑战性。

3. 全球性与高效性

交易几乎实时发起,无需考虑国界限制。无论是邻居间的小额转账还是跨境大额支付,网络处理效率保持一致。

4. 安全性

资金由加密系统保护,只有私钥持有者才能授权转账。分布式验证机制防止中间人攻击和交易篡改。

交易验证与矿工确认流程

内存池:交易的等候区

已签名交易首先进入内存池(mempool),等待矿工选取打包。未确认交易可能在此停留数分钟至数小时,取决于网络拥堵状况和手续费设置。

工作量证明与区块构建

矿工选择交易包含至新区块前需完成两项工作:

  1. 验证交易有效性:确认发送方UTXO确实存在且未花费
  2. 解决数学难题:通过计算寻找符合网络难度目标的随机数(nonce)

确认次数的意义

区块被加入区块链后获得第一次确认,后续每个新区块都为其增加一次确认。确认数越多,交易被逆转的可能性越低,安全性相应提高。

交易确认时间与影响因素

标准确认时间

比特币网络平均每10分钟产生一个新区块。通常需要6个确认(约1小时)方可视为最终确认,但小额交易可能只需1-3个确认即被接受。

延迟原因解析

大额交易确认建议

比特币交易的优势与局限

优势分析

  1. 自主控制:用户完全掌控资金,无需第三方授权即可转账
  2. 点对点传输:直接在不同主体间转移价值,消除中介环节
  3. 低成本存储:钱包内长期存币无管理费,交易费用远低于传统跨境汇款
  4. 跨境效率:国际支付通常数分钟完成,手续费不受转账金额影响

当前局限性

  1. 价格波动性:币值短期波动可能影响商品交易中的实际结算价值
  2. 确认时间可变:网络拥堵时确认时间延长,不适合即时零售场景
  3. 接受度有限:虽越来越多商家接受比特币,但仍未成为主流支付方式

常见问题

比特币是什么?

比特币是一种基于密码学技术的去中心化数字货币,由化名为中本聪的个人或团队创建。交易记录存储在名为区块链的公共账本上,新币通过“挖矿”过程产生。

能否使用比特币购物?

可以。比特币已在许多在线商城和部分实体商店作为支付手段被接受。作为加密货币,它依靠密码学保障交易安全并控制新币发行。其去中心化特性意味着不受任何政府、银行或中央机构控制。

比特币投资是否安全?

比特币价格波动较大且确认速度有时较慢,投资需谨慎评估风险。尽管存在这些挑战,许多人认为加密货币有潜力改变我们对货币的认知和使用方式。


通过本文对比特币交易机制的全面解析,我们可以看到其技术设计既体现了创新性也存在实际应用中的权衡。理解这些基本原理有助于用户更安全、高效地使用这一新兴支付系统。